Force Motors Limited Disclosure Regarding Receipt of Communication from SEBI

Force Motors Limited has formally disclosed the receipt of an email query from the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I) dated February 4, 2026. The communication pertains to clarifications sought regarding the Company’s announcement of Unaudited Financial Results for the Quarter and nine months ended December 31, 2023. Additionally, SEBI requested details concerning a significant fluctuation in the company’s stock price observed between February 15, 2024, and February 20, 2024.

Regulatory Compliance Disclosure

Force Motors Limited has issued a formal disclosure regarding a regulatory communication received under Regulation 30 requirements. The communication, classified as an Email, originated from the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I) and was received on February 4, 2026.

Summary of SEBI Query

The core of the communication involves a request from SEBI seeking specific clarifications and supporting details from the Company. These details relate directly to the results announcement made on February 12, 2024, covering the Unaudited Financial Results (both Standalone and Consolidated) for the Quarter and nine months concluded on December 31, 2023. Furthermore, SEBI specifically asked for supporting information regarding a period of significant stock price movement observed between February 15, 2024, and February 20, 2024. The period applicable to the financial communication under review is the Financial Year 2023-24.

Company Response and Impact

Force Motors Limited has confirmed that, at this time, there is no material impact on the financial operations of the Company resulting from this inquiry. There were no aberrations, non-compliances, penalties, or sanctions identified or imposed by the authority in the communication.

The Company has committed to action, stating that it will file a suitable reply to SEBI concerning these matters within the prescribed regulatory timeline.
